To convert dollars per pound to dollars per ton, you need to consider the fact that there are 2,000 pounds in one ton. So, you would multiply the dollars per pound value by 2,000 to get the equivalent value in dollars per ton. This conversion is important when comparing prices of items sold in different units of measurement, such as when dealing with commodities like metals or agricultural products.

1 ton = 2000 pounds

Multiply the known dollars/pound x 2000 pounds/ton. For example, to convert 12.8 dollars/pound into dollars/ton, do the following:

12.8 dollars/pound x 2000 pounds/ton = 25600 dollars/ton.
